Cone on battling 'Mr. Upshaw': 'It's almost like we are babies'

Tim Cone also gave new Blackwater coach Pat Aquino his flowers

BARANGAY Ginebra coach Tim Cone hailed Blackwater coach Pat Aquino, import Robert Upshaw, and the rest of the Bossing for making Friday's win very difficult for them.

The Gins defeated the Bossing, 115-108, but had to earn it after Upshaw exploded for 43 points in Aquino's fourth game as new head coach.

“Mr. Upshaw, and I'm calling him Mr. Upshaw, he is a man,” said Cone. “He is a very large human being and he knows how to use his body and he moves well. He is awesome. We just had a hard time handling Mr. Upshaw.”

Japeth Aguilar, Troy Rosario, and even Justin Brownlee took turns in guarding the 7-foot Blackwater behemoth, aad even prior to the game, they knew that it was going to be a hard task.

“When we watched him on video against San Miguel, we were commenting that June Mar looked like a little boy next to him. And we look like little boys next to June Mar. It's almost like we are babies to Mr. Upshaw. It was tough,” said Cone.

Cone gives coach Pat his flowers

Cone said Upshaw was in full strength with Aquino knowing how to use his pieces.

“Got to give a lot of credit to Coach Pat Aquino. He's got those guys turned on. He is playing his personnel really well. His rotations are great. He kept Mr. Upshaw on the bench just long enough to keep him fresh and I thought he did a heck of a job,” Cone shared.

Barangay Ginebra played catch up after a 23-3 Blackwater start. But even after taking the drivers’ seat in the later part of the game, the Gins still needed a clutch three from second-stringer Nards Pinto to hold off the Bossing.

“We always say that those starts are like artificial. It's like one team just isn't making shots all of a sudden. But we just told the guys to let's locked in to the defense. We will figure them out offensively. The shots will start to fall. But we had to lock in defensively, which we weren't,” said Cone.

“Big guy (Upshaw) came out, hit two four-pointers right in the beginning of the game. And then Tratter hit a three-pointer from the corner. We knew Mr. Upshaw can shoot four-pointers. We saw that against San Miguel and in previous games. But still, it was quite surprising. Even though you know he is going to make it, then he does.”

“To me, we had opportunities in the third quarter to really break the game open. But Blackwater showed great character to stay in the game. They actually took the lead in the fourth. It was a true struggle not because we didn't play well, but because Blackwater played great,” said Cone.
